What is the Oregon Linn County Building?

The Oregon Linn County Building serves as a central hub for various governmental functions, including planning, zoning, and building permits. It is essential for residents and businesses in Linn County to understand its role in facilitating construction and development projects. The building houses departments that oversee compliance with local codes and regulations, ensuring that all projects align with safety and environmental standards.

Steps to complete the Oregon Linn County Building

Completing processes related to the Oregon Linn County Building typically follows a structured path:

  • Determine the type of permit or application needed.
  • Gather all required documentation, such as property deeds and project plans.
  • Fill out the necessary forms accurately, ensuring all information is complete.
  • Submit the forms either online, by mail, or in person, depending on the department's guidelines.
  • Pay any associated fees, which may vary based on the application type.
  • Await feedback or approval from the relevant department.

Required Documents

When engaging with the Oregon Linn County Building, specific documents are typically required. These may include:

  • Completed application forms for permits or licenses.
  • Site plans or blueprints of proposed projects.
  • Proof of ownership or authorization from property owners.
  • Environmental assessments, if applicable.
  • Any previous correspondence with county officials regarding the project.
